summ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orLeonardo Boshell <leonardop@gentoo.org>2004-09-03 09:07:13 +0000
committerLeonardo Boshell <leonardop@gentoo.org>2004-09-03 09:07:13 +0000
commit8908d90ef0f23a6c8763a6d82b09e298286bbb78 (patch)
tree50feefaa14cc5cf0277a0983142062e0a041f53d /app-office/glabels
parentStable x86. (Manifest recommit) (diff)
downloadgentoo-2-8908d90ef0f23a6c8763a6d82b09e298286bbb78.tar.gz
gentoo-2-8908d90ef0f23a6c8763a6d82b09e298286bbb78.tar.bz2
gentoo-2-8908d90ef0f23a6c8763a6d82b09e298286bbb78.zip
New version, including patch to avoid sandbox violation (bug #60545)
Diffstat (limited to 'app-office/glabels')
-rw-r--r--app-office/glabels/ChangeLog9
-rw-r--r--app-office/glabels/Manifest11
-rw-r--r--app-office/glabels/files/digest-glabels-2.0.01
-rw-r--r--app-office/glabels/files/digest-glabels-2.0.11
-rw-r--r--app-office/glabels/files/glabels-2.0.1-sandbox_fix.patch12
-rw-r--r--app-office/glabels/glabels-2.0.1.ebuild (renamed from app-office/glabels/glabels-2.0.0.ebuild)8
6 files changed, 34 insertions, 8 deletions
diff --git a/app-office/glabels/ChangeLog b/app-office/glabels/ChangeLog
index 96272b127c1c..bad1d897a614 100644
--- a/app-office/glabels/ChangeLog
+++ b/app-office/glabels/ChangeLog
@@ -1,6 +1,13 @@
# ChangeLog for app-office/glabels
# Copyright 1999-2004 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/app-office/glabels/ChangeLog,v 1.2 2004/08/18 17:31:38 gustavoz Exp $
+# $Header: /var/cvsroot/gentoo-x86/app-office/glabels/ChangeLog,v 1.3 2004/09/03 09:07:13 leonardop Exp $
+
+*glabels-2.0.1 (03 Sep 2004)
+
+ 03 Sep 2004; L. Boshell <leonardop@gentoo.org> glabels-2.0.1.ebuild,
+ files/glabels-2.0.1-sandbox_fix.patch:
+ New version. Added patch to fix a potential sandbox violation when
+ desktop-file-utils is installed. Resolves bug #60545.
18 Aug 2004; Gustavo Zacarias <gustavoz@gentoo.org> glabels-1.93.3.ebuild:
Stable on sparc
diff --git a/app-office/glabels/Manifest b/app-office/glabels/Manifest
index 088a79201320..ade353d19ebe 100644
--- a/app-office/glabels/Manifest
+++ b/app-office/glabels/Manifest
@@ -1,6 +1,9 @@
-MD5 78deb371c6ffce2cd588316f33658f06 ChangeLog 2054
-MD5 ab002f8bde4d44c83f613d09a152faef glabels-1.93.3.ebuild 964
-MD5 14539f5217d39d361b3aab0274f97005 glabels-2.0.0.ebuild 1036
+MD5 715b0e2080335f389f12d4586a5e5e3b ChangeLog 2277
MD5 54b7f17aa1f3cf4e8cc03858fd99070c metadata.xml 554
-MD5 9e2ffe73924322314756d4f75f0f7298 files/digest-glabels-1.93.3 67
+MD5 ab002f8bde4d44c83f613d09a152faef glabels-1.93.3.ebuild 964
+MD5 c2f8827879b968b54c7c359466d27907 glabels-2.0.0.ebuild 1131
+MD5 c2f8827879b968b54c7c359466d27907 glabels-2.0.1.ebuild 1131
MD5 beeadac937d901cb1fe5fb039672d3cc files/digest-glabels-2.0.0 66
+MD5 9e2ffe73924322314756d4f75f0f7298 files/digest-glabels-1.93.3 67
+MD5 81f9fc011c0c65da556b38f4eae30d5e files/glabels-2.0.0-sandbox_fix.patch 415
+MD5 42fee8564da4e38b5e06395d87648ee4 files/digest-glabels-2.0.1 66
diff --git a/app-office/glabels/files/digest-glabels-2.0.0 b/app-office/glabels/files/digest-glabels-2.0.0
deleted file mode 100644
index c8d8105c57b8..000000000000
--- a/app-office/glabels/files/digest-glabels-2.0.0
+++ /dev/null
@@ -1 +0,0 @@
-MD5 77a421ee35b64f01a0fbf5ada5944add glabels-2.0.0.tar.gz 1408734
diff --git a/app-office/glabels/files/digest-glabels-2.0.1 b/app-office/glabels/files/digest-glabels-2.0.1
new file mode 100644
index 000000000000..a0655e8e3a90
--- /dev/null
+++ b/app-office/glabels/files/digest-glabels-2.0.1
@@ -0,0 +1 @@
+MD5 d6658de86c76f9f333ed28ac11ca22f9 glabels-2.0.1.tar.gz 1415676
diff --git a/app-office/glabels/files/glabels-2.0.1-sandbox_fix.patch b/app-office/glabels/files/glabels-2.0.1-sandbox_fix.patch
new file mode 100644
index 000000000000..f35e695d3a28
--- /dev/null
+++ b/app-office/glabels/files/glabels-2.0.1-sandbox_fix.patch
@@ -0,0 +1,12 @@
+diff -NurdB glabels-2.0.1-orig/configure glabels-2.0.1/configure
+--- glabels-2.0.1-orig/configure 2004-09-03 03:38:05 -0500
++++ glabels-2.0.1/configure 2004-09-03 03:38:45 -0500
+@@ -9383,7 +9383,7 @@
+ ;;
+ esac
+ fi
+-UPDATE_DESKTOP_DATABASE=$ac_cv_path_UPDATE_DESKTOP_DATABASE
++UPDATE_DESKTOP_DATABASE=no
+
+ if test -n "$UPDATE_DESKTOP_DATABASE"; then
+ echo "$as_me:$LINENO: result: $UPDATE_DESKTOP_DATABASE" >&5
diff --git a/app-office/glabels/glabels-2.0.0.ebuild b/app-office/glabels/glabels-2.0.1.ebuild
index 582183432f12..94e17653a94d 100644
--- a/app-office/glabels/glabels-2.0.0.ebuild
+++ b/app-office/glabels/glabels-2.0.1.ebuild
@@ -1,8 +1,8 @@
# Copyright 1999-2004 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/app-office/glabels/glabels-2.0.0.ebuild,v 1.1 2004/08/10 23:21:02 leonardop Exp $
+# $Header: /var/cvsroot/gentoo-x86/app-office/glabels/glabels-2.0.1.ebuild,v 1.1 2004/09/03 09:07:13 leonardop Exp $
-inherit gnome2
+inherit eutils gnome2
DESCRIPTION="Program for creating labels and business cards"
HOMEPAGE="http://glabels.sourceforge.net/"
@@ -32,6 +32,10 @@ DOCS="AUTHORS ChangeLog NEWS README TODO"
src_unpack() {
unpack ${A}
+
# Small syntax correction.
sed -i -e 's:;Office:;Office;:' ${S}/data/desktop/glabels.desktop.in
+
+ # Avoid sandbox violation. See bug #60545.
+ epatch ${FILESDIR}/${P}-sandbox_fix.patch
}